1. Biscayne National Park

Biscayne National Park

Image Source

If you are in Miami and have an urge to snorkel, Biscayne National Park is one of the best places to quench your thirst for snorkeling. The blue and beautiful sea water and the sea turtles will attract you to the shore and rest assured, you will have the best time of your life. They allow only one snorkel boat per day which takes a maximum of 49 people in the boat. The boat departs daily at 1:30 PM and takes you to the snorkeling spot.

Average Cost: $32.5 per person
Address: 9700 SW 328th Street Sir Lancelot Jones Way, Homestead, FL 33033

3. Tarpoon Lagoon Diving Center

Tarpoon Lagoon

Image Source

Tarpoon lagoon diving offers snorkeling for the people who have a thing for marine adventures. They are recognized internationally as a leader in all aspects of scuba diving education. It is one of the oldest dive shops in the state of Florida and is located at the Miami Beach Marina at 300 ALTON Road in the fifth neighborhood of the South Beach. They also give you the right diving suggestions and communication related to diving techniques so that you can enjoy your snorkeling trip to the fullest. If you are planning for a snorkeling trip, you must visit this place as they have experience of 64 years and expert instructors who will help you make the most of the tour.

Average Cost: $80 +tax per person.
Address: 300 Alton Rd #110, Miami Beach, FL 33139, USA

4. South Beach Divers

South Beach Divers

Image Source

South Beach offers snorkeling and scuba diving equipment for rents so that you do not have to go anywhere else to rent the masks and other equipment. In addition to the rental and sales equipment, they also arrange a full day snorkeling trip to explore the coral reef inside the marine sanctuary at John Pennekamp State Park. Shuttle service to the park is provided on Tue, Thu and Sat which departs at 10 AM and returns at 7 PM the same day.

Average Cost: $75 per person.
Address: 850 Washington Ave, Miami Beach, FL 33139, USA

7. Devil’s Den Spring

Devil’s Den Spring

Image Source

Devil’s Den is known for some of the most exotic experiences for the snorkelers. The depth for snorkeling is 60 feet and the diver gets to see some underwater caves as well. Devil’s Den takes you closest to nature and the marine life and gives you a thrilling experience of aquatic lives under water. You get only 2 hours inside the den because of the huge number of visitors. After 2 hours, you can remain on the property but have no access to the Den.

Average Cost: $15 per person
Address: 5390 N.E 180th Ave Williston, FL 32696
